    Ribbon Nomination for Sparhawk and Icon

    Distinguished Defense



    Game: Professional Counter-Strike

    Map: Cs_Siege_PCS

    Team: Terrorists

    Date: 07 May 2008

    Description:

    These two fellow players of mine are great communicators and are very good defensive men. They follow orders, and give them with ease. They hold their ground the best they can, falling back if need be, and show exceptional skill in this. Here is one instance on the map Siege.

    On this map, if you do not know, is a garage with 2 entrances that the Counter-Terrorists can breach from. The two entrances are the Sewer Entrance, and the Above-Ground Entrance. Icon and Sparhawkxx were both located in this area looking at these two entrances, along with me. Sparhawkxx was mainly guarding the sewer entrance, while peeking in to help Icon if he called it at the Above-Ground entrance. They had good defensive cover, a car for Sparhawkxx, and a pillar for Icon.

    One of our first skirmishes was only with me and Icon, while Spar was guarding somewhere in the back. Anyway, Icon was above guarding up top (Getting no action), while I pushed out to the sewer entrance, hoping to surprise the cautious Counter-Terrorists. But in return, they surprised me by rushing me! There was 3 of em, easily pushing me back and hurting me in the process. I called Icon for support, and he put it where I needed it. He opened fire at the doorway, and helped fend off the rush. Two of them died within around 10 seconds of me exiting the door, while the third waited in ambush. I was hurt bad, and was falling back to the hostages, but in the process I got shot in the back by the lone wolf. Almost immediately after I died, Icon took him out, and helped win the round.

    The next few rounds were all similar, with Sparhawkxx aiding the cause. Most of the rounds he helped guard sewers, while Icon guarded the Above-ground entrance. Icon held his ground expertly, with the occasional help of Sparhawkxx, and we only had to fall back once or twice to reinforce the Armory.

    On the last round (We were doing a good 6-0 on them with this good defense) we were rushed. After getting in behind some cars and a pillar, we waited. A fellow terrorist pushed up a bit and got picked off by a sniper. Icon pulled back to not get picked off, while a smoke was tossed in the entrance. The smoked blocked mostly all visibility, and with the aid of a flash they rushed in. We hid in cover, then poked our heads out to take a couple shots. We hit, they didn't. With aid from our cover, they got destroyed pretty easily. We regained the garage within about a minute. When the smoke was thrown, 5 Counter-Terrorists stormed in, and when the smoke dissipated, 5 Counter-Terrorist bodies were found.

    Conclusion:

    I think these two great defenders deserve something in response to their great skill, communication, and tactical excellence. They showed me that they are very good at defending that garage, and helped our team win with a shutout.
